.section--main-cart{padding-block:var(--fluid-32-48)}.section--main-cart__inner{display:flex;flex-direction:column;gap:var(--fluid-20-28);padding-inline:var(--fluid-10-60);padding-bottom:var(--fluid-32-48);border-bottom:1px solid var(--color-foreground);max-width:var(--page-width, 1920px);margin-inline:auto;width:100%}@media screen and (min-width:1000px){.section--main-cart__inner{gap:var(--fluid-30-30)}}.cart-page__header{display:flex;align-items:center;width:100%;padding-bottom:var(--fluid-24-32)}.cart-page__breadcrumb{margin:0;font-family:var(--font-display-family);font-weight:var(--font-display-weight);font-stretch:expanded;font-size:var(--fluid-18-24);line-height:normal;letter-spacing:var(--letter-spacing-display);text-transform:uppercase;color:var(--color-foreground)}.cart-page__empty{display:flex;flex-direction:column;align-items:center;gap:var(--fluid-16-24);padding:var(--fluid-64-64) 0;text-align:center}.cart-page__empty-text{margin:0;font-family:var(--font-body-family);font-size:var(--fluid-18-24);color:var(--color-foreground)}.cart-page__empty-link{font-family:var(--font-body-family);font-size:var(--fluid-16-20);color:var(--color-foreground);text-decoration:underline;text-underline-offset:.15em}.cart-page__empty-link:hover,.cart-page__empty-link:focus-visible{opacity:.7}.cart-page__layout{display:grid;grid-template-columns:1fr;gap:var(--fluid-24-40)}@media screen and (min-width:1000px){.cart-page__layout{grid-template-columns:minmax(0,1fr) minmax(320px,var(--fluid-400-400));gap:var(--fluid-40-60);align-items:start}}.cart-page__items-head{display:none}@media screen and (min-width:1000px){.cart-page__items-head{display:grid;grid-template-columns:var(--fluid-150-150) 1fr auto auto;gap:var(--fluid-24-32);padding-bottom:var(--fluid-12-16);border-bottom:1px solid var(--color-foreground);font-family:var(--font-body-family);font-size:var(--fluid-12-14);text-transform:uppercase;letter-spacing:.05em;color:var(--color-foreground);opacity:.6}.cart-page__items-head>span:nth-child(2){grid-column:2 / 3}.cart-page__items-head>span:nth-child(3){grid-column:3 / 4;text-align:center}}.cart-page__items{list-style:none;margin:0;padding:0;display:flex;flex-direction:column}.cart-page__item{display:grid;grid-template-columns:var(--fluid-129-129) 1fr;grid-template-rows:auto auto;grid-template-areas:"image info" "qty total";gap:var(--fluid-16-24);padding-block:var(--fluid-24-32);border-bottom:1px solid var(--color-foreground)}.cart-page__item:last-child{border-bottom:none}@media screen and (min-width:1000px){.cart-page__item{grid-template-columns:var(--fluid-150-150) 1fr auto auto;grid-template-rows:auto;grid-template-areas:"image info qty total";gap:var(--fluid-24-32);align-items:start}}.cart-page__item-image-link{grid-area:image;display:block;text-decoration:none}.cart-page__item-image{width:100%;aspect-ratio:1440 / 2160;object-fit:cover;background-color:var(--color-foreground-subtle, color-mix(in srgb, var(--color-foreground) 8%, transparent));display:block}.cart-page__item-info{grid-area:info;display:flex;flex-direction:column;gap:var(--fluid-8-12);min-width:0}.cart-page__item-title{margin:0;font-family:var(--font-body-family);font-weight:var(--font-body-weight-bold);font-size:var(--fluid-16-20);line-height:var(--line-height-tight)}.cart-page__item-title a{color:inherit;text-decoration:none}.cart-page__item-title a:hover,.cart-page__item-title a:focus-visible{text-decoration:underline;text-underline-offset:.15em}.cart-page__item-props{display:flex;flex-direction:column;gap:var(--fluid-4-4);font-family:var(--font-body-family);font-size:var(--fluid-14-16);color:var(--color-foreground)}.cart-page__item-prop{display:inline-flex;align-items:center;gap:var(--fluid-8-8)}.cart-page__item-prop--color{text-transform:capitalize}.cart-page__item-swatch{width:var(--fluid-15-20);height:var(--fluid-15-20);flex:0 0 auto;background-color:var(--swatch-1, var(--color-foreground));background-image:linear-gradient(135deg,var(--swatch-1, transparent) 0 50%,var(--swatch-2, var(--swatch-1, transparent)) 50% 100%);border:1px solid color-mix(in srgb,var(--color-foreground) 30%,transparent)}.cart-page__item-remove{align-self:flex-start;-webkit-appearance:none;appearance:none;background:none;border:0;padding:0;font-family:var(--font-body-family);font-size:var(--fluid-14-16);color:var(--color-foreground);text-decoration:underline;text-underline-offset:.15em;cursor:pointer;transition:opacity .15s ease}.cart-page__item-remove:hover,.cart-page__item-remove:focus-visible{opacity:.7}.cart-page__item-qty{grid-area:qty;display:inline-flex;align-items:center;gap:var(--fluid-12-16);border:1px solid var(--color-foreground);padding:var(--fluid-4-6) var(--fluid-8-12);align-self:start;width:max-content}.cart-page__qty-btn{-webkit-appearance:none;appearance:none;background:none;border:0;padding:0;width:var(--fluid-24-24);height:var(--fluid-24-24);font-family:var(--font-body-family);font-size:var(--fluid-18-24);line-height:1;color:var(--color-foreground);cursor:pointer;transition:opacity .15s ease}.cart-page__qty-btn:hover:not(:disabled),.cart-page__qty-btn:focus-visible:not(:disabled){opacity:.7}.cart-page__qty-btn:disabled{opacity:.4;cursor:not-allowed}.cart-page__qty-value{font-family:var(--font-body-family);font-weight:var(--font-body-weight-bold);font-size:var(--fluid-16-20);min-width:var(--fluid-20-24);text-align:center}.cart-page__item-total{grid-area:total;display:flex;flex-direction:column;align-items:flex-end;gap:var(--fluid-4-4);font-family:var(--font-body-family);font-weight:var(--font-body-weight-bold);font-size:var(--fluid-16-20);color:var(--color-foreground)}.cart-page__item-compare{font-weight:var(--font-body-weight);font-size:var(--fluid-14-16);opacity:.55}.cart-page__summary{display:flex;flex-direction:column;gap:var(--fluid-16-24);padding:var(--fluid-24-32);border:1px solid var(--color-foreground)}.cart-page__summary-title{margin:0;font-family:var(--font-display-family);font-weight:var(--font-display-weight);font-stretch:expanded;font-size:var(--fluid-18-24);letter-spacing:var(--letter-spacing-display);text-transform:uppercase;color:var(--color-foreground)}.cart-page__summary-row{display:flex;justify-content:space-between;align-items:baseline;font-family:var(--font-body-family);font-size:var(--fluid-16-20);color:var(--color-foreground)}.cart-page__summary-value{font-weight:var(--font-body-weight-bold)}.cart-page__summary-note{margin:0;font-family:var(--font-body-family);font-size:var(--fluid-12-14);color:var(--color-foreground);opacity:.7}.cart-page__checkout{display:flex;align-items:center;justify-content:center;padding:var(--fluid-12-16) var(--fluid-16-24);background:var(--color-button, var(--color-foreground));color:var(--color-button-label, var(--color-background));font-family:var(--font-body-family);font-weight:var(--font-body-weight-bold);font-size:var(--fluid-16-20);text-transform:uppercase;letter-spacing:.05em;text-decoration:none;transition:opacity .15s ease,transform .15s ease}.cart-page__checkout:hover,.cart-page__checkout:focus-visible{opacity:.9;color:var(--color-button-label, var(--color-background))}.cart-page__continue{text-align:center;font-family:var(--font-body-family);font-size:var(--fluid-14-16);color:var(--color-foreground);text-decoration:underline;text-underline-offset:.15em}.cart-page__continue:hover,.cart-page__continue:focus-visible{opacity:.7;color:var(--color-foreground)}@media(prefers-reduced-motion:reduce){.cart-page__checkout,.cart-page__qty-btn,.cart-page__item-remove{transition:none}}
/*# sourceMappingURL=/cdn/shop/t/11/assets/section-main-cart.css.map */
